LlamaREST-IPD (GGUF)

LlamaREST-IPD is a Small Language Model (SLM) fine-tuned to predict inter-parameter dependencies (IPDs) among REST API parameters, used by LlamaRestTest to improve automated REST API test generation.

It is one of the two SLMs used by LlamaRestTest; the companion model, LlamaREST-EX, generates realistic example values for parameters.

Training

Fine-tuned from Llama-3-8B with QLoRA, then quantized with llama.cpp (Q6_K). Key hyperparameters:

  • 4-bit precision (nf4), compute dtype float16, no nested quantization
  • LoRA: r=64, alpha=16, dropout 0.1
  • 5 epochs, batch size 4, paged_adamw_32bit, LR 2e-4, weight decay 0.001, constant schedule, warmup ratio 0.03

Training data (Inter-Parameter Dependency): random1234321/REST-IPD.
